Why a Traditional Sale Wasn’t an Option

The seller had already tried the obvious route. She listed the home online, hoping to find a buyer on her own. Interest dropped off quickly. Once people learned about the past-due lot rent, they stopped taking the listing seriously.

Working with a real estate agent wasn’t possible either. In South Carolina, a mobile home that isn’t attached to real property is titled through the South Carolina Department of Motor Vehicles, which classifies it as personal property. Agents can’t sell it like a traditional house. She was left with a property she couldn’t keep and couldn’t sell, which added to her problems.

The tax side added even more pressure. In Richland County, manufactured homes are owned and transferred by title through the SCDMV, and they are still assessed for property tax. For a seller already behind, the clock would keep on running until she could find a way to offload it.
